The Govern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ress in Edo State, Osagie Ize-Iyamu, on Thursday shutdown his entire campaign ahead of the September 19 election.

The decision was disclosed in a statement signed by the chairman of the Edo state APC media campaign council, John Mayaki.

This is to thank all the citizens of Edo State at home and abroad for your solidarity and to announce that the Edo State All Progressives Congress (APC) Campaign Council and the Pastor Osagie Ize-Iyamu Campaign Organisation will close its campaign for the Office of the Governor of Edo State by 10PM on Thursday, 17 September 2020.”

“We are overwhelmed by the massive support, the plethora of endorsements, the approval and reception of our SIMPLE agenda, and the valiant spirit of Edo people, which we encountered in all the 192 wards of our powerful state. With all your support and participation, we are assured that our candidate will commence the good work of reinstating democracy and resurrecting Edo state as soon as possible.”

“The public is hereby enjoined to disregard any campaign-related material that may purport to come from our council, and we encourage the good people of Edo to remain vigilant, safe, dogged and unyielding to oppression as the election draws closer.”
